Output 5feab77500ccc64a307b5344ee5643c9a2966b232436cfaf6b69ead5d21860db:0

value
2605779
script pubkey
OP_0 OP_PUSHBYTES_20 cfb99970c6f550574eb5740eb2be10cdf1776044
address
ltc1qe7uejuxx74g9wn44ws8t90ssehchwczyrf84ud
transaction
5feab77500ccc64a307b5344ee5643c9a2966b232436cfaf6b69ead5d21860db
spent
true